Karim Jaffal is a scholar working on Infectious Diseases, Epidemiology and Surgery. According to data from OpenAlex, Karim Jaffal has authored 21 papers receiving a total of 131 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 8 papers in Infectious Diseases, 7 papers in Epidemiology and 5 papers in Surgery. Recurrent topics in Karim Jaffal’s work include Orthopedic Infections and Treatments (4 papers), Respiratory Support and Mechanisms (3 papers) and Respiratory viral infections research (3 papers). Karim Jaffal is often cited by papers focused on Orthopedic Infections and Treatments (4 papers), Respiratory Support and Mechanisms (3 papers) and Respiratory viral infections research (3 papers). Karim Jaffal collaborates with scholars based in France. Karim Jaffal's co-authors include Saad Nseir, Sophie Six, G. Ledoux, Florent Wallet, Emmanuelle Jaillette, Pierre de Truchis, Benjamin Davido, Farid Zerimech, Bruno Mégarbane and Anahita Rouzé and has published in prestigious journals such as Frontiers in Immunology, Critical Care and International Journal of Antimicrobial Agents.
